407 }
408
409 /**
410  * Based on sequence number algorithm as specified in RFC 2203.
411  *
412  * Modified for our own problem: arriving request has valid sequence number,
413  * but unwrapping request might cost a long time, after that its sequence
414  * are not valid anymore (fall behind the window). It rarely happen, mostly
415  * under extreme load.
416  *
417  * Note we should not check sequence before verifying the integrity of incoming
418  * request, because just one attacking request with high sequence number might
419  * cause all following requests be dropped.
420  *
421  * So here we use a multi-phase approach: prepare 2 sequence windows,
422  * "main window" for normal sequence and "back window" for fall behind sequence.
423  * and 3-phase checking mechanism:
424  *  0 - before integrity verification, perform an initial sequence checking in
425  *      main window, which only tries and doesn't actually set any bits. if the
426  *      sequence is high above the window or fits in the window and the bit
427  *      is 0, then accept and proceed to integrity verification. otherwise
428  *      reject this sequence.
429  *  1 - after integrity verification, check in main window again. if this
430  *      sequence is high above the window or fits in the window and the bit
431  *      is 0, then set the bit and accept; if it fits in the window but bit
432  *      already set, then reject; if it falls behind the window, then proceed
433  *      to phase 2.
434  *  2 - check in back window. if it is high above the window or fits in the
435  *      window and the bit is 0, then set the bit and accept. otherwise reject.
436  *
437  * \return       1:     looks like a replay
438  * \return       0:     is ok
439  * \return      -1:     is a replay
440  *
441  * Note phase 0 is necessary, because otherwise replay attacking request of
442  * sequence which between the 2 windows can't be detected.
443  *
444  * This mechanism can't totally solve the problem, but could help reduce the
445  * number of valid requests be dropped.
446  */
447 static
448 int gss_do_check_seq(unsigned long *window, __u32 win_size, __u32 *max_seq,
449                      __u32 seq_num, int phase)
450 {
451         LASSERT(phase >= 0 && phase <= 2);
452
453         if (seq_num > *max_seq) {
454                 /*
455                  * 1. high above the window
456                  */
457                 if (phase == 0)
458                         return 0;
459
460                 if (seq_num >= *max_seq + win_size) {
461                         memset(window, 0, win_size / 8);
462                         *max_seq = seq_num;
463                 } else {
464                         while(*max_seq < seq_num) {
465                                 (*max_seq)++;
466                                 __clear_bit((*max_seq) % win_size, window);
467                         }
468                 }
469                 __set_bit(seq_num % win_size, window);
470         } else if (seq_num + win_size <= *max_seq) {
471                 /*
472                  * 2. low behind the window
473                  */
474                 if (phase == 0 || phase == 2)
475                         goto replay;
476
477                 CWARN("seq %u is %u behind (size %d), check backup window\n",
478                       seq_num, *max_seq - win_size - seq_num, win_size);
479                 return 1;
480         } else {
481                 /*
482                  * 3. fit into the window
483                  */
484                 switch (phase) {
485                 case 0:
486                         if (test_bit(seq_num % win_size, window))
487                                 goto replay;
488                         break;
489                 case 1:
490                 case 2:
491                      if (__test_and_set_bit(seq_num % win_size, window))
492                                 goto replay;
493                         break;
494                 }
495         }
496
497         return 0;
498
499 replay:
500         CERROR("seq %u (%s %s window) is a replay: max %u, winsize %d\n",
501                seq_num,
502                seq_num + win_size > *max_seq ? "in" : "behind",
503                phase == 2 ? "backup " : "main",
504                *max_seq, win_size);
505         return -1;
506 }
507
508 /*
509  * Based on sequence number algorithm as specified in RFC 2203.
510  *
511  * if @set == 0: initial check, don't set any bit in window
512  * if @sec == 1: final check, set bit in window
513  */
514 int gss_check_seq_num(struct gss_svc_seq_data *ssd, __u32 seq_num, int set)
515 {
516         int rc = 0;
517
518         spin_lock(&ssd->ssd_lock);
519
520         if (set == 0) {
521                 /*
522                  * phase 0 testing
523                  */
524                 rc = gss_do_check_seq(ssd->ssd_win_main, GSS_SEQ_WIN_MAIN,
525                                       &ssd->ssd_max_main, seq_num, 0);
526                 if (unlikely(rc))
527                         gss_stat_oos_record_svc(0, 1);
528         } else {
529                 /*
530                  * phase 1 checking main window
531                  */
532                 rc = gss_do_check_seq(ssd->ssd_win_main, GSS_SEQ_WIN_MAIN,
533                                       &ssd->ssd_max_main, seq_num, 1);
534                 switch (rc) {
535                 case -1:
536                         gss_stat_oos_record_svc(1, 1);
537                         /* fall through */
538                 case 0:
539                         goto exit;
540                 }
541                 /*
542                  * phase 2 checking back window
543                  */
544                 rc = gss_do_check_seq(ssd->ssd_win_back, GSS_SEQ_WIN_BACK,
545                                       &ssd->ssd_max_back, seq_num, 2);
546                 if (rc)
547                         gss_stat_oos_record_svc(2, 1);
548                 else
549                         gss_stat_oos_record_svc(2, 0);
550         }
551 exit:
552         spin_unlock(&ssd->ssd_lock);
553         return rc;
554 }
